Significance

Security officials blame the spike in violence on the influence of drug trafficking organisations (DTOs), which have long transited the country but which increasingly are vying to control routes and markets within it.

Impacts

US officials will deepen cooperation with Costa Rica, particularly on addressing fentanyl trafficking.

Insecurity will not necessarily dissuade investors but could encourage more spending on private security.

The situation will present opportunities for a populist, security-focused candidate in the 2026 election.
